| Stacey Earle and Mark Stuart met for the first time 1992 at a songwriters night in Nashville TN. They knew that night it was one of them things that are just meant to be. They were married in 1993 while raising 2 children from Stacey’s first marriage. “When we got married I knew Mark understood he was marrying all three of us and on that day he did." Stacey waiting tables, Mark playing night after night in and around Nashville from gigs to sessions balancing time to play their own music. Stacey and Mark each had their own solo careers that started to make a move by opening their own Indie record label Gearle Records in 1998 with the release of Stacey’s Simple Gearle CD followed by Mark’s 1999 release Songs From A Corner Stage and continuing on with Stacey’s 2002 Dancing With Them That Brung Me, before Stacey and Mark would announce their husband and wife duo in 2001 with the release of their (Double Live CD) Must Be Live. “It would be quite a balancing act at that time raising a family and trying to make a living along with all the other stuff that came with getting by, “but we managed”. Mark Stuart went to the finest of Music schools. Mark started his schooling listening and admiring his uncle’s guitar playing and his Dads fiddling. He would find himself playing in the School of Honky Tonks and Beer Joints in and around Nashville by age 15 in his Dads band. by managing to stay awake in high school after playing late nights polishing every riff and bend and vocal chord he would go on by age 17 to form his own band make a record and still find the time to play on the road as lead guitar and vocals for acts like Freddy Fender and more taking him into his 20's. They live in Ashland City TN west of Nashville but call home from the road most of the time. “Our children are all grown so we left home” for the past three years. They've gone on to release their Duo albums, together 2003 Never Gonna Let You Go and now 2005 “S&M Communion Bread. Stacey and Mark are no doubt together till death do they part.
